What Do You Do with the Roofing Shingles?

A requirement for any type of roofing job, regardless of it is replacing old roof shingles or a full re-roofing, is a roll-off dumpster. The only other options are filling countless trash receptacles into a vehicle or employing an expensive junk removal business to grab the discarded roofing material at your house. The quantity of waste that a roofing project can generate is surprising. You don't understand how large your roof covering is until you see a pile of your old roof shingles comprising a mound in your front lawn. A stack of discard shingles is not something with which the majority of people wish to deal. They are a hazard with sharp nails sticking out from the shingles. These two issues are why you need to rent a roll-off dumpster to guarantee tiles aren't strewn across your backyard and you don't need to transport them to the garbage dump yourself.
